1. Job story

Be Smart tìm kiếm ứng viên cho vị trí Mobile Dev với vai trò phát triển hệ thống của khách hàng. Khi tham gia cùng chúng tôi, bạn sẽ có nhiều cơ hội cho bản thân:

  • Làm việc trong dự án lớn cùng những nhân sự cao cấp / chuyên gia.
  • Sử dụng công nghệ mới, bắt trend xu hướng về CNTT.
  • Training on job nếu bạn cần đào tạo thêm về dự án.

2. Nội dung công việc: 

  • Tham gia vào dự án phát triển phần mềm cho khách hàng khối ngân hàng tại Hà Nội.
  • Tìm hiểu yêu cầu, phân tích dự án và coding cho hệ thống internet banking.

3. Để đáp ứng công việc bạn cần

Level 1:

  • Tốt nghiệp hệ chính quy một trong các chuyên ngành: CNTT, Toán Tin, Điện tử viễn thông Hoặc có chứng chỉ lập trình viên tương đương (Aptech, Quốc tế)
  • Tối thiểu 2 năm làm việc thực tế tại các công ty, dự án về lập trình Mobile (Đặc biệt với iOS và Android) 
  • Có kiến thức và kinh nghiệm về lập trình React Native (Bắt buộc), Objective C/Swift hoặc Android java, kotlin
  • Có kiến thứcvà kinh nghiệm sử dụng thành thạo IDE XCode, Android studio, các công cụ hỗ trợ (Simulator, Instrument),
  • Có khả năng nắm vững các khái niệm OOP, MVC, MVVM, Layout, API,…
  • Có các kỹ năng lập trình tốt như: phân tích, đưa giải pháp để giải quyết các vấn đề;

Level 2:

  • Bao gồm toàn bộ các yêu cầu chung của level 1
  • Tối thiểu 2 năm kinh nghiệm Team Leader với các công việc đã từng thực hiện như:
  • Tham gia triển khai các dự án về lập trình Mobile (Đặc biệt với iOS và Android), trực tiếp lập trình và hỗ trợ các thành viên trong nhóm lập trình.
  • Tham gia phân tích nghiệp vụ, đề xuất giải pháp, phương án triển khai nhằm cải tiến, nâng cao hiệu quả của các dự án trong quá trình làm việc.
  • Lên timeline công việc, lấy xác nhận từ các bên liên quan và chia tasks cho các thành viên trong nhóm, giám sát và hỗ trợ các thành viên hoàn thành đúng cam kết.
  • Dẫn dắt nhóm 3-6 người, giúp thành viên cùng phát triển và hoàn thành nhiệm vụ được giao

Level 3:

  • Có kiến thức chuyên sâu về Design Partern
  • Có kiến thức chuyên sâu về securities cho các ứng dụng App
  • Phân tích và xử lý được các vấn đề liên quan đến hiệu năng của App
  • Nắm rõ các kiến trúc công nghệ để phát triển như React-Hook, Firebase
  • Có khả năng phân tích logging của App.
  • Có thể phát triển các công việc liên quan đến Backend, sử dụng Java, MessageQueue, MicroService

4. Sẽ là điểm cộng nếu bạn

  • Có kinh nghiệm kiểm thử trong lĩnh vực tài chính / ngân hàng;
  • Có khả năng đọc viết tiếng Anh (cơ bản) nghe nói (nếu có thể);
  • Có kiến thức tốt về SCM tools bao gồm Git, subversion.
  • Có hiểu biết và kinh nghiệm thiết kế UI/UX, Material design,API,DB.
  • Đã từng tham gia triển khai các dự án theo mô hình Agile/Scrum

JOB ĐÃ TUYỂN ĐỦ NHÂN SỰ